ABOUT OLIVER SCHREER
Oliver Schreer is Associate Professor at Technical University Berlin and Head of Immersive Media & Communication Group at Vision & Imaging Technologies Department at Fraunhofer Heinrich-Hertz-Institute (HHI). In this context he is engaged in research for real-time 3D videoprocessing, future immersive media applications, 3D video conferencing systems, human motion and gesture analysis. For his research on 3D Human Body Reconstruction (3DHBR), Oliver Schreer and his colleagues Ingo Feldmann and Peter Kauff have been awarded in May 2019 with the Joseph-von-Fraunhofer Prize entitled by \"Realistic people in virtual worlds - A movie as a true experience\". Since Oliver Schreer was involved in several European research projects acting as workpacka leader or coordinator, e.g. FP6 RUSHES, FP7 3DPresence, FP7 FascinatE and FP7 inEvent. Since November 2018, he is coordinating the H2020 Coordination and Support Action XR4ALL (xr4all.eu). In November he finished his PhD in electrical engineering at the Technical University of Berlin. Since 2001, Oliver Schreer is Adjunct Professor at the Faculty of Electrical Engineering and Computer Science, Technical University Berlin. He is giving a complementary set of lectures on stereo image processing view synthesis. In June 2006, Oliver Schreer received his habilitation degree in the field of \"Computer Vision/Videocommunication\" at the Technical University Berlin. His habilitation thesis is a german lecture book on \"Stereoanalysis and View Synthesis\" published at Springer in 2005. Since November 2006, Oliver Schreer is Associate Professor (Privatdozent) in the same faculty in the Computer Vision and Remote Sensing Group. He published more than 100 papers in conferences and journals. He is also editor of a book on \"3D Videocommunication\" published in 2005 at Wiley & Sons, UK. The same book has been translated to simple Chinese and published in July 2010 by Tsinghua University Beijing, China. In January 2014, another book was published at Wiley & Sons entitled by \"Media Production, Delivery and Interaction for Platform Independent Systems: Format-Agnostic Media\" that has been edited by O. Schreer, J-F. Macq, O.A. Niamut, J. Ruiz-Hidalgo, B. Shirley, G. Thallinger and G. Thomas.
